Albertsons Taps Criteo For Retail Media Ecosystem

Albertsons Media Collective, the retail media arm for the Albertsons Cos., has begun a new partnership with Criteo to enhance its on-site sponsored ad offerings. At the same time, Criteo plans to expand to newer ad formats such as commerce display and sponsored video. Together, the partners will offer CPG brands access to premium inventory […]

Big Y Names Michael D’ Amour Next President, CEO

The Board of Directors of Big Y Foods Inc. has announced several executive changes, beginning Jan. 21. Charles L. D’Amour will step down as president and CEO and become executive chairman of the board as the reins move to Michael P. D’Amour. Rouses Magazine Celebrates Food, Culture Along Gulf Coast

Rouses magazine celebrates the food and culture of the Gulf Coast. The Louisiana-based grocer’s publication marked its 10th anniversary in 2023 and continues to grow in popularity. The Giant Company’s Feeding School Kids Initiative Returns

The Giant Company has announced the return of its fourth annual Feeding School Kids initiative.
